Replacing the batteries

The battery indicator in the display

window shows the battery condition.

When

flashes, replace the batteries

with new ones.

When

flashes, the batteries are

exhausted and the unit will stop

operation.
Battery life* (With continuous use)

In the HQ mode
Recording:

Approx. 11 hr.

Playback:

Approx. 7.5 hr.

FM recording:

Approx. 5 hr.

FM reception:

Approx.13 hr.

In the SP and LP modes
Recording:

Approx. 22 hr.

Playback:

Approx.11 hr.

FM recording:

Approx.7 hr.

FM reception:

Approx.13 hr.

(hr.: hours)

* Using Sony alkaline batteries LR03 (size AAA)

* When playing back through the internal

speaker with the medium volume level

The battery life may shorten depending on the

operation of the unit.

Notes

Do not use manganese batteries for this unit.
When you replace the batteries with new

ones, the clock setting display appears.

In this case, set the date and time again.

The recorded messages and alarm setting,

however, will remain.
When replacing the batteries, be sure to

replace both batteries with new ones.
Do not charge dry batteries.
When you are not going to use the unit for

a long time, remove the batteries to prevent

damage from battery leakage and corrosion.
The unit is accessing data while “ACCESS“

appears in the display window or the OPR

indicator flashes in orange. While accessing,

do not remove the batteries. Doing so may

damage the data.
